Victim in West Columbia shooting on Friday morning identified

WEST COLUMBIA, S.C. — Authorities have identified a man who died after being shot in West Columbia on Friday.

The Lexington County Sheriff’s Department confirmed that they were called to the 200 block of Hammond Avenue in the morning hours. First responders were first called to the area when deputies said a person who was bleeding started knocking on doors and asking for help.

The person was taken to an area hospital but died. While details about the incident haven’t been released publicly, the sheriff’s department said it appeared to be an isolated incident involving two people who knew each other and had a prior connection…
